Getting There

From central Wellington, take the northern motorway, driving around the harbor toward Lower Hutt, and follow the signs to Wairarapa. Once on this route, you head over the Rimutaka Hills and arrive in Featherston, the southernmost village in Wairarapa, around 1 1/2 hours later.

If you're entering the area from the north, it takes 3 hours from Napier and 1 hour from Palmerston North to reach Masterton. Flying to Martinborough from Wellington by helicopter takes just 15 minutes.

Visitor Information

In Masterton, the Masterton Visitor Centre, 316 Queen St. (tel. 06/370-0900; fax 06/378-8451; www.wairarapanz.com), is open daily Monday to Friday 9am to 5pm, and weekends 10am to 4pm. If you don't intend to drive the extra 30 minutes north from Featherston/Martinborough, check out the office at 18 Kitchener St., Martinborough (tel. 06/306-9043; martinborough@wairarapanz.com).
